aseprite/README.md

115 lines
6.8 KiB
Markdown
Raw Normal View History

# Aseprite
2016-01-04 15:29:19 +00:00
*Copyright (C) 2001-2016 David Capello*
2015-06-08 18:57:15 +00:00
[![Build Status](https://travis-ci.org/aseprite/aseprite.svg)](https://travis-ci.org/aseprite/aseprite)
[![Gitter](https://badges.gitter.im/Join%20Chat.svg)](https://gitter.im/aseprite/aseprite?utm_source=badge&utm_medium=badge&utm_campaign=pr-badge&utm_content=badge)
## Introduction
2013-03-28 02:13:43 +00:00
**Aseprite** is an open source program to create animated sprites.
Its main features are:
2015-09-30 19:40:47 +00:00
* Sprites are composed by [**layers** & **frames**](http://www.aseprite.org/docs/timeline/) (as separated concepts).
2015-09-30 11:58:12 +00:00
* Supported [color modes](http://www.aseprite.org/docs/color/): **RGBA**, **Indexed** (palettes up to 256
colors), and Grayscale.
2015-09-30 11:58:12 +00:00
* Load/save sequence of **PNG** files and **GIF** animations (and
2013-03-28 02:13:43 +00:00
FLC, FLI, JPG, BMP, PCX, TGA).
* Export/import animations to/from **Sprite Sheets**.
* **Tiled** drawing mode, useful to draw **patterns** and textures.
* **Undo/Redo** for every operation.
2015-09-30 11:58:12 +00:00
* Real-time **animation preview**.
* [**Multiple editors**](http://www.aseprite.org/docs/workspace/#drag-and-drop-tabs) support.
2015-09-30 11:58:12 +00:00
* Pixel-art specific tools like filled **Contour**, **Polygon**, [**Shading**](http://www.aseprite.org/docs/shading/) mode, etc.
* **Onion skinning**
2013-03-28 02:13:43 +00:00
## Issues
2014-11-21 01:07:53 +00:00
There is a list of
[Known Issues](https://github.com/aseprite/aseprite/issues) (things
2013-03-28 02:13:43 +00:00
to be fixed or that aren't yet implemented).
2014-11-21 01:09:22 +00:00
If you found a bug or have a new idea/feature for the program,
[you can report them](https://github.com/aseprite/aseprite/issues/new).
2013-03-28 02:13:43 +00:00
## Support
2013-03-28 02:13:43 +00:00
You can ask for help in:
2015-01-19 01:07:23 +00:00
* Our official support email address: [support@aseprite.org](mailto:support@aseprite.org)
2016-04-15 13:18:19 +00:00
* [Aseprite Steam Community](https://steamcommunity.com/app/431730/discussions/)
* [Aseprite mailing list](http://groups.google.com/group/aseprite-discuss) ([subscribe](mailto:aseprite-discuss+subscribe@googlegroups.com))
2015-01-19 01:07:23 +00:00
* Social networks and community-driven places:
[Twitter](https://twitter.com/aseprite/),
[Facebook](https://facebook.com/aseprite/),
[YouTube](https://www.youtube.com/user/aseprite),
[Google+](https://plus.google.com/+AsepriteOrg/posts),
[IRC](http://webchat.freenode.net/?channels=aseprite),
[DeviantArt](https://aseprite.deviantart.com/).
## Authors
2012-05-04 02:05:16 +00:00
* David Capello [davidcapello@gmail.com](mailto:davidcapello@gmail.com) <br />
Programmer, designer, and maintainer. <br />
2015-02-28 00:03:46 +00:00
http://davidcapello.com/
2012-05-04 02:05:16 +00:00
* Ilija Melentijevic <br />
2015-01-19 01:07:23 +00:00
New GUI skin for Aseprite v0.8. A lot of good ideas. <br />
http://ilkke.blogspot.com/ <br />
http://www.pixeljoint.com/p/9270.htm
2012-05-04 02:05:16 +00:00
* Contributors <br />
2015-06-15 16:05:19 +00:00
http://www.aseprite.org/contributors/
Thanks to all the people who have contributed ideas, patches, bugs
report, feature requests, donations, and help me developing Aseprite.
## Credits
2015-09-30 11:58:12 +00:00
Aseprite includes color palettes created by:
* [Richard "DawnBringer" Fhager](http://pixeljoint.com/p/23821.htm) palettes, [16 colors](http://pixeljoint.com/forum/forum_posts.asp?TID=12795), [32 colors](http://pixeljoint.com/forum/forum_posts.asp?TID=16247).
* [Arne Niklas Jansson](http://androidarts.com/) palettes, [16 colors](http://androidarts.com/palette/16pal.htm), [32 colors](http://wayofthepixel.net/index.php?topic=15824.msg144494).
It tries to replicate some pixel-art algorithms:
* [RotSprite](http://forums.sonicretro.org/index.php?showtopic=8848&st=15&p=159754&#entry159754) by Xenowhirl.
* [Pixel perfect drawing algorithm](http://deepnight.net/pixel-perfect-drawing/) by [Sébastien Bénard](https://twitter.com/deepnightfr) and [Carduus](https://twitter.com/CarduusHimself/status/420554200737935361).
And it uses the following third-party libraries:
2014-10-17 00:30:27 +00:00
* [Allegro 4](http://alleg.sourceforge.net/) - [allegro4 license](https://github.com/aseprite/aseprite/tree/master/docs/licenses/allegro4-LICENSE.txt)
* [FreeType](http://www.freetype.org/) - [FTL license](https://github.com/aseprite/aseprite/tree/master/docs/licenses/FTL.txt)
2015-09-30 11:58:12 +00:00
* [Google Test](https://github.com/google/googletest) - [gtest license](https://github.com/aseprite/aseprite/tree/master/docs/licenses/gtest-LICENSE.txt)
2015-01-19 01:07:23 +00:00
* [XFree86](http://www.x.org/) - [XFree86 license](https://github.com/aseprite/aseprite/tree/master/docs/licenses/XFree86-LICENSE.txt)
* [curl](http://curl.haxx.se/) - [curl license](https://github.com/aseprite/aseprite/tree/master/docs/licenses/curl-LICENSE.txt)
2016-04-06 18:37:13 +00:00
* [duktape](http://duktape.org/) - [MIT license](https://github.com/aseprite/aseprite/tree/master/third_party/duktape/LICENSE.txt)
2015-01-19 01:07:23 +00:00
* [giflib](http://sourceforge.net/projects/giflib/) - [giflib license](https://github.com/aseprite/aseprite/tree/master/docs/licenses/giflib-LICENSE.txt)
2014-10-17 00:30:27 +00:00
* [libjpeg](http://www.ijg.org/) - [libjpeg license](https://github.com/aseprite/aseprite/tree/master/docs/licenses/libjpeg-LICENSE.txt)
* [libpng](http://www.libpng.org/pub/png/) - [libpng license](https://github.com/aseprite/aseprite/tree/master/docs/licenses/libpng-LICENSE.txt)
2015-09-01 11:31:33 +00:00
* [libwebp](https://developers.google.com/speed/webp/) - [libwebp license](https://chromium.googlesource.com/webm/libwebp/+/master/COPYING)
2014-10-17 00:30:27 +00:00
* [loadpng](http://tjaden.strangesoft.net/loadpng/) - [zlib license](https://github.com/aseprite/aseprite/tree/master/docs/licenses/ZLIB.txt)
2016-04-06 18:37:13 +00:00
* [modp_b64](https://github.com/aseprite/aseprite/tree/master/third_party/modp_b64/modp_b64.h) - [BSD license](https://github.com/aseprite/aseprite/tree/master/third_party/modp_b64/LICENSE)
2015-01-19 01:07:23 +00:00
* [pixman](http://www.pixman.org/) - [MIT license](http://cgit.freedesktop.org/pixman/plain/COPYING)
2014-10-17 00:32:08 +00:00
* [simpleini](https://github.com/aseprite/simpleini/) - [MIT license](https://github.com/aseprite/simpleini/blob/aseprite/LICENCE.txt)
2015-01-19 01:07:23 +00:00
* [tinyxml](http://www.sourceforge.net/projects/tinyxml) - [zlib license](https://github.com/aseprite/aseprite/tree/master/docs/licenses/ZLIB.txt)
2014-10-17 00:30:27 +00:00
* [zlib](http://www.gzip.org/zlib/) - [ZLIB license](https://github.com/aseprite/aseprite/tree/master/docs/licenses/ZLIB.txt)
2015-01-19 01:07:23 +00:00
## License
2016-02-16 21:32:50 +00:00
This program is distributed under three different licenses:
2016-08-26 20:02:58 +00:00
1. Source code and official releases/binaries are distributed under
our [End-User License Agreement for Aseprite (EULA)](EULA.txt). Please check
that there are [modules/libraries in the source code](src/README.md) that
are distributed under the MIT license
(e.g. [base](https://github.com/aseprite/aseprite/tree/master/src/base),
[she](https://github.com/aseprite/aseprite/tree/master/src/she),
[clip](https://github.com/aseprite/clip), etc.).
2. You can request a special
[educational license](http://www.aseprite.org/faq/#is-there-an-educational-license)
in case you are a teacher in an educational institution and want to
use Aseprite in your classroom (in-situ).
3. Steam releases are distributed under the terms of the
2016-02-16 21:32:50 +00:00
[Steam Subscriber Agreement](http://store.steampowered.com/subscriber_agreement/).
2016-08-26 20:02:58 +00:00
You can get more information about Aseprite license in the
[FAQ](http://www.aseprite.org/faq/#licensing-&-commercial).